Methanol is toxic because it is metabolized to:
A. Ethanol
B. Acetic acid
C. Formaldehyde and formic acid
D. Acetone
Answer: Option C
Solution (By JKExamLibrary)
In the liver, methanol is oxidized to formaldehyde, then to formic acid, which damages the optic nerve and can cause blindness or death. Ethanol is used as an antidote by competing for the enzyme alcohol dehydrogenase.

Question #1
Which acid is called the 'King of Chemicals'?
A. Sulphuric acid
B. Phosphoric acid
C. Nitric acid
D. Hydrochloric acid

Correct Answer: Option A


Explanation:
Sulphuric acid is used in the production of fertilizers, chemicals, petroleum refining, etc., earning the title. It's not the strongest acid but the most industrially important.

Question #2
The scientist who first proposed that electrons move in specific orbits around the nucleus was:
A. James Chadwick
B. Ernest Rutherford
C. Niels Bohr
D. J. J. Thomson

Correct Answer: Option C


Explanation:
Niels Bohr in 1913 proposed the planetary model where electrons revolve in certain allowed circular orbits without radiating energy, with quantized angular momentum. Rutherford proposed the nuclear model but did not specify quantized orbits. Thomson gave plum pudding. Chadwick discovered neutron.

Question #3
In the modern periodic table, the element with atomic number 117 belongs to:
A. Group 18, Period 6
B. Group 1, Period 7
C. Group 17, Period 7
D. Group 17, Period 6

Correct Answer: Option C


Explanation:
Element 117 (tennessine, Ts) is a halogen in Group 17, Period 7. The modern periodic table has 7 periods and 18 groups. Halogens are in Group 17. Period 7 starts with Fr (87) and ends with Og (118). Ts is two places before Og. Exam trick: For atomic numbers after 86 (Rn), use period 7. Group 17 elements are F, Cl, Br, I, At, Ts.
